What is Blockchain?

Blockchain is a technology that allows data to be recorded in a digital form that cannot be changed or deleted. Blockchain consists of a peer-to-peer network of computers that work together to validate and record transactions into a digital ledger called a “blockchain”. Each block in the blockchain contains information about the transactions that have taken place, including the date, time, and quantity of the transaction.

How Does Blockchain Improve Cybersecurity?

Blockchain has several features that make it very effective in improving cybersecurity. Here are some ways blockchain can improve cybersecurity:

  1. Data Security : Blockchain uses cryptographic technology to protect data stored in the blockchain. Data stored in the blockchain cannot be changed or deleted, making it very difficult to manipulate by unauthorized parties.
  2. Transparency : Blockchain allows transactions to be conducted transparently, allowing the parties involved to track and monitor transactions in real-time.
  3. Privacy Separation : Blockchain allows for greater privacy by using digital addresses that are not tied to the user’s real identity.
  4. Resilience : Blockchain is designed to withstand severe cyber attacks, making it extremely difficult to destroy.
  5. Audit Trail : Blockchain allows detailed tracking of transactions, thereby enabling more effective investigations in cases of cyber attacks.
